#5db15f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5db15f is composed of 36.5% red, 69.4%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 121.4 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 52.9%. #5db15f color hex could be obtained by blending #baffbe with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#5db15f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a05 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5db15f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#8f8f8f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#859685 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b3a361 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c39d6f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#79abb8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#93a860 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9ea469 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#6fad97 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
